A throwback to the 70s, when it was common for manufacturers to use an existing/proven engine in their own chassis and brand name.. ie, Sachs motors in early Penton/KTMs, etc

I had no idea Yamaha owns Motor Minarelli... there's another motor that's been used in all kinds of different brand bikes..

The Fantic Super Rocket 50 (right) was a popular little racer in the early 70’s. It used a Minarelli motor back then too, the Italjet Tarbo next to it ran the same engine.
